Fourth season of Sudamerican Master Dota 2 tournament will kick off on 22nd of February.
The prestigious South-American tournament returns its fourth season where 16 teams will battle for a share at the $4,000 prize pool. 10 teams were directly invited to the tournament and will be joined by six more squads coming from the open qualifiers.
The format of the tournament features two phases, beginning with a group stage followed by a double elimination bracket. For the group stage, the 16 attending teams are divided into four groups of four, with a bo2 round robin. The top two teams of each group will advance to the double elimination bracket, with all the matches being best-of-three, and the grand finals being best-of-five.

The total of $4,000 prize pool up for grabs is distributed as follows:
1st place: $2,400
2nd place: $1,040
3rd place: $560
